Purpose of the Award

The ENRE Best Publication Awards are given annually to the best refereed journal articles in the areas of interest of ENRE, published two calendar years prior to the year in which the award is given. The objective of the award is to recognize the contributions of ENRE members to the respective research areas. Nominated publications will be judged by separate committees of three members for each area with respect to impact and originality.
